Steve Loughran commented on HADOOP-12074:
-----------------------------------------

Good idea.
I'd recommend going one step further and throwing an 
{{InterruptedIOException(cause)}} so the caller can act on it without looking 
inside

> in Shell.java#runCommand() while catching InterruptedException, throw new 
> IOException(ie) instead of IOException(ie.getMessage())

> Instead of creating IOException with message make InterruptedException the 
> cause of IOException, so that whoever calling shell executor can make use of 
> it.
